Courtlands Hill in Pangbourne is up for sale for £1,500,000.
Estate agents, Sansome and George, explained: “This property is conveniently situated to give easy access to the village with all of its amenities including shops, bars, and cafes.
“There is a host of highly regarded schools including the local junior school in the village and Bradfield college nearby which are all easily accessible.
“This property offers flexible accommodation to suit most families and for the commuter there is a main line station nearby giving access to Oxford and Reading.
“The M4 motorway is approx. only a 10 - 20-minute drive and has a bus route serving Reading.”
